What affects the price

When you look at the price of impact windows, several factors shift the final number. The size and quantity of your window openings are the biggest drivers, as is the specific style—like single-hung, casement, or sliding doors. You will also see price differences based on the type of glass coating you choose for energy efficiency and the thickness of the aluminum or vinyl frames. Added hardware features or custom finishes can also adjust the bottom line. What is an impact window?

An impact window is designed to withstand forceful impacts from wind-borne debris, a critical feature for homes in areas prone to severe weather like Raleigh. They are constructed with a strong interlayer between two panes of glass that prevents the glass from shattering upon impact. This significantly enhances the protection and safety of your home during storms.

What are the drawbacks of impact windows?

Some homeowners might notice a slight tint or color distortion with impact windows due to the specialized glass layers, which can subtly affect natural light. The initial investment is also typically higher than for standard windows. However, for residents in Raleigh facing unpredictable weather, the enhanced durability, security, and potential for reduced insurance premiums are significant advantages.
